UART (Universal Asynchronous Receiver/Transmitter) — это стандартная функция, которая позволяет обмениваться данными между микроконтроллером и другими устройствами. Многие платы разработки и промышленные устройства имеют UART-порты, которые используются для отладки, конфигурирования и обмена данными.
Однако, не всегда легко определить, где на плате находится UART-порт и какие контакты использовать. В этой статье мы расскажем, как найти UART на плате и дадим несколько полезных советов по его определению.
Первое, что следует сделать, это изучить документацию на плату. В ней должно быть указано, есть ли на плате UART-порты, где они расположены и какие контакты использовать. Обратите внимание на названия контактов, обычно они имеют префикс «UART» или «RX/TX».
Если в документации информация отсутствует или недостаточно ясна, то можно воспользоваться следующим методом. Часто UART-порты на платах имеют стандартный распиновку, в которой используются контакты TX (передача данных) и RX (прием данных), а также контакты GND (земля) и VCC (питание). Поэтому, просмотрите плату и найдите контакты, обозначенные как «TX», «RX» или «GND». Вероятнее всего, это будут UART-порты.
Как определить UART на плате: основные принципы и методы
Основные принципы и методы для идентификации UART на плате включают:
- Обзор документации – первым шагом необходимо внимательно изучить документацию к плате. Обычно в документации указывается количество и расположение портов UART на плате, а также их конфигурация (например, скорость передачи данных, биты данных и контроль четности).
- Визуальный осмотр – визуальный осмотр платы может помочь обнаружить наличие физических портов UART. Обычно они имеют характерные разъемы, такие как 9-контактный D-sub или 3-контактный разъем.
- Поиск меток и надписей – многие платы имеют метки или надписи, указывающие на наличие портов UART. Они могут быть обозначены как «UART», «RX», «TX» или номерами портов (например, «UART1», «UART2» и т.д.).
- Проверка схемы платы – иногда необходимо проверить схему платы для точного определения портов UART. Это может потребовать изучения схематической документации, которую можно получить у производителя платы.
- Программное определение – существуют специальные программы и инструменты, которые могут помочь определить порты UART на плате. Они позволяют сканировать доступные порты и обнаруживать соответствующие UART-устройства.
Используя вышеуказанные принципы и методы, можно успешно определить порты UART на плате и настроить соответствующее взаимодействие с устройствами, подключенными к ним.
Обзор UART и его назначение
Основное назначение UART – обеспечение последовательной (потоковой) связи между устройствами. Он широко применяется во множестве различных приложений, таких как коммуникационные интерфейсы, управление периферийными устройствами (например, дисплеями или сенсорными экранами), передача данных и отладка программного обеспечения.
UART обычно работает в асинхронном режиме, что означает, что данные передаются без использования внешней синхронизации. Вместо этого, перед началом передачи каждого байта, передающая сторона генерирует стартовый бит, за которым следуют сами данные и один или два бита проверки четности. Принимающая сторона считывает данные, используя стартовый бит и затем выполняет проверку четности для определения правильности полученных данных.
Важными характеристиками UART являются скорость передачи данных (baud rate), биты данных (data bits), биты проверки четности (parity bits) и стоповые биты (stop bits). Настройка этих параметров позволяет контролировать скорость передачи данных и точность их передачи.
Анализ печатной платы: где искать UART
При поиске UART на печатной плате следует обратить внимание на несколько ключевых мест, где обычно располагается данный интерфейс.
Во-первых, стоит искать UART вблизи микроконтроллера или процессора. Часто UART находится рядом с контактами, предназначенными для программирования или отладки микроконтроллера. Если на плате есть маркировка, сигнализирующая о наличии UART, то это может значительно облегчить процесс его поиска.
Во-вторых, необходимо обратить внимание на наличие компонентов связанных с UART. Например, резисторы, конденсаторы или интегральные схемы, которые обеспечивают обработку UART сигналов. Часто эти компоненты находятся рядом с соответствующими контактами или имеют маркировку, указывающую на связь с UART.
Кроме того, следует обратить внимание на печатные проводники, которые ведут от интерфейсных контактов микроконтроллера или процессора. Узкий проводник, подключенный к контроллеру и направленный к определенному участку платы, может указывать на наличие UART на этом участке.
Не стоит забывать и о разъемах, которые могут использоваться для подключения UART. USB разъемы или разъемы для последовательного порта (RS-232) могут указывать на наличие данного интерфейса на плате.
Определение UART на печатной плате требует внимательного анализа всех компонентов и проводников. Необходимо учитывать разные конфигурации и расположение компонентов на плате. Следуя указанным рекомендациям, можно значительно упростить поиск UART и избежать ошибок при подключении и настройке данных интерфейсов.
Использование многофункциональных микросхем для определения UART
Для определения UART на плате можно использовать специальные многофункциональные микросхемы, которые помогут вам с легкостью выявить наличие и расположение UART-портов. Эти микросхемы имеют ряд преимуществ, которые делают процесс определения UART более удобным и эффективным.
Одно из главных преимуществ многофункциональных микросхем — их универсальность. Они способны работать с различными типами UART, такими как RS-232, RS-485, RS-422 и другими. Также эти микросхемы поддерживают разные скорости передачи данных, что позволяет использовать их с широким спектром устройств и протоколов связи.
Для использования многофункциональных микросхем в процессе определения UART необходимо подключить их к нужным портам на плате и использовать специальную программу для работы с микросхемой. Программа позволяет сканировать порты и определять наличие UART-портов, а также получать информацию о скорости передачи данных и других параметрах подключенных устройств.
Одна из популярных многофункциональных микросхем для определения UART — FTDI FT232R. Она имеет маленький размер и может быть легко подключена к портам на плате. FT232R поддерживает большое количество различных настроек и может работать с широким спектром устройств.
При использовании многофункциональных микросхем для определения UART рекомендуется следовать инструкциям производителя и обращаться к документации по подключению и настройке микросхемы. Также стоит учесть, что в некоторых случаях может потребоваться дополнительная настройка и программирование микросхемы для определения UART на плате.
В целом, использование многофункциональных микросхем значительно упрощает процесс определения UART на плате. Они предоставляют удобный и эффективный способ выявления наличия UART-портов и помогают сэкономить время и усилия при разработке и отладке устройств.
Программные методы и инструменты поиска UART
Поиск UART с использованием программных методов и инструментов может быть эффективным способом определения UART на плате. Вот несколько практических советов и рекомендаций для проведения поиска:
- Использование программного обеспечения для сканирования портов. Существуют специальные утилиты, такие как UARTScan, которые позволяют сканировать доступные порты и определять, являются ли они UART.
- Использование командной строки. В некоторых операционных системах можно воспользоваться командой, такой как «ls /dev/tty\*» или «ls /dev/serial\*». Это поможет вывести список доступных серийных портов.
- Использование программ для мониторинга портов. Программы, такие как PuTTY, RealTerm или Serial Port Monitor, позволяют открывать порты и просматривать отправляемые и принимаемые данные, что может помочь в определении UART.
- Использование анализатора регистрационных данных. Анализаторы регистрационных данных, например Saleae Logic Analyzer, позволяют перехватывать и анализировать серийные данные, что может помочь в определении UART и идентификации передаваемых данных.
При использовании программных методов и инструментов для поиска UART на плате важно учесть, что результаты могут быть приблизительными и требуют дополнительной проверки и анализа. Также стоит обратить внимание на документацию платы или микроконтроллера, которая может содержать информацию о расположении UART и его параметрах.
Практические советы и рекомендации по поиску UART на плате
Поиск UART на плате может быть сложной задачей, особенно для начинающих разработчиков. Однако, имея определенные знания и правильные инструменты, можно значительно упростить этот процесс. В этом разделе приведены практические советы и рекомендации, которые помогут вам определить UART на плате более эффективно.
1. Изучите документацию и схему платы: Прежде чем начать поиск UART, ознакомьтесь с документацией и схемой платы. Обратите внимание на разъемы и компоненты, которые могут быть связаны с UART, такие как микросхемы UART, разъемы для подключения UART-кабеля и пины, которые могут использоваться для UART-связи.
2. Визуальный поиск: Визуально исследуйте плату, ищите надписи, символы или маркировки, указывающие на наличие UART. Такие маркировки могут быть различными в зависимости от производителя платы, но обычно они связаны с UART, например, «RX» и «TX», «UART», «SERIAL» или «COM». Также обратите внимание на разъемы, которые могут быть предназначены для подключения UART-кабеля.
3. Используйте мультиметр: Если у вас есть мультиметр, вы можете использовать его для измерения напряжения на пинах платы и проверки, активен ли UART. Подключите частью плюсовой (+) провод мультиметра к массе платы и попробуйте подключить ножку мультиметра к пинам, которые могут быть связаны с UART. На UART-пинах можно наблюдать низкое напряжение в режиме ожидания, а также уровень изменяется при передаче и приеме данных.
4. Используйте программные инструменты: Вам также могут помочь программные инструменты для поиска UART на плате. Например, вы можете использовать программу для онлайн-анализа плат, которая позволяет вам исследовать электрические сигналы платы и выделить потенциальные UART-пины. Также существуют специализированные программы для работы с UART, которые позволяют обнаружить и установить подключение к UART.
Следуя этим практическим советам и рекомендациям, вы сможете более эффективно определить UART на плате. Имейте в виду, что различные платы могут иметь разные способы и методы подключения UART, поэтому не стесняйтесь использовать сочетание различных инструментов и подходов для достижения наилучших результатов.